Audiobooks Like Carl's Doomsday Scenario

Read more

Jeff Hays narrates Matt Dinniman's Dungeon Crawler Carl sequel with the kind of shameless comedic commitment the LitRPG genre requires — the 11-hour runtime sustains the absurdist premise because Hays never lets the dungeon feel like a backdrop when it should feel like a character, and he handles the tonal whiplash between gross-out horror and genuine pathos without flinching. The pacing is relentless, which is part of the joke. All ten picks are highly rated, match the runtime closely, and pull from the same progression fantasy space where the comedy and the stakes are equally real.

How We Rank Audiobooks

Rankings are driven by listener ratings and review counts from Audible and Goodreads. Books with high ratings across a large number of listeners rank higher — a 4.5 with 50,000 ratings says more than a 4.8 with 200.

Unlike most book lists, we weight audiobook-specific factors: narrator performance, production quality, and how well a story translates to audio. A great book with a poor narration isn't a great audiobook.

We don't accept paid placements or prioritize new releases. These rankings reflect what listeners actually enjoy, not what's being promoted.

Rankings update periodically as new ratings come in and new titles are added to the collection.
